Understanding WooCommerce

WooCommerce is an open-source eCommerce platform for WordPress that powers more than 3 million online stores. The platform is built and supported by Woo and provides you with all the tools you need to support your online business idea. To get started with this platform, you will either need to choose a host, such as WordPress, Bluehost, SiteGround, or more, and then install the plug-in to build a new online store or migrate your existing store to WooCommerce.

Furthermore, WooCommerce enables you to sell everything, including simple products, customizable bundles, and downloads, through your store. You can also add extensions for bookings, selling subscriptions, and more. This popular eCommerce plug-in has several helpful features for users, like:

1. Product Management

One of the hardest things to figure out when starting an online business is how to sort and manage product inventory on the website. WooCommerce allows you to segment your products into different categories, which helps with product management and navigation. The best part is that you can freely customize the product by adding specific attributes, like color, size, and other categories. Additionally, you can provide special prices, like discounts and promos, to enhance sales and reduce inventory for efficient stock management.

2. Shopping Rules

This particular feature of WooCommerce can be adjusted and designed to the needs of sellers to make it easier for buyers to order numerous products. It is helpful in defining the customer journey when purchasing from your shop. It usually begins with the ordering process, followed by payment, and then product refunds.

3. Order Management

You can monitor all orders sent by your customers on the website with this feature. Sellers can further create offline orders manually. WooCommerce also helps streamline your order management process by integrating with your sales, Customer Relationship Management (CRM) platform, and email hosting services. Furthermore, WooCommerce also syncs your orders across all other marketplaces you may be selling your products and services on for a multi-channel selling experience. 

4. Sales Report

WooCommerce has a built-in sales report feature that enables you to add extensions if the default report feels less comprehensive. A few report extensions even let you export various reports either into Excel or CSV documents for easy sharing and analysis to help with your business development and sales improvement. These WooCommerce extensions have affordable pricing as well. 

5. Flexible Payments

WooCommerce provides several payment methods, like cash on delivery (COD), digital payments,  bank transfers, and others. The payment methods offered by the platform are fully compatible with other payment gateways like PayPal, Doku, and Stripe. Moreover, you can even use the WooCommerce payment extension, WooPayment, for no setup or processing fees. 

WooCommerce Pricing

WooCommerce is a free-to-use WordPress plug-in. However, it offers a paid enterprise version of the plug-in with more functionalities, such as personalized support and guidance with a success manager, a robust point-of-sale feature for syncing offline and online businesses, and advanced customization. The WooCommerce enterprise pricing is not standard and will depend on your business size, the infrastructure and level of support you need, and specific requirements. You can provide your business information for a custom quote.

Moreover, WooCommerce offers 850 different extensions that you can use to enhance your online store's functionality. These include payment gateways, shipping options, marketing tools, and customer support features. Each extension is designed to cater to specific business needs and improve shopping experiences. The WooCommerce extensions' pricing ranges from $0 to $299. 

Here is a look at WooCommerce pricing for a few extensions that may be beneficial for your business.

  • WooCommerce Subscriptions: $23.25 per month/ $279 per year
  • Checkout Field Editor: $4.09 per month/ $49 per year
  • WooCommerce Bookings: $20.75 per month/ $249 per year
  • Gift Cards: $6.59 per month/ $79 per year

Limitations of WooCommerce

WooCommerce offers several benefits to its users, but, like several other platforms, it has its fair share of challenges and limitations. These include:

1. Need to Be a WordPress User

It is usually presumed that all eCommerce endeavors necessitate using WordPress to support their respective online stores. WooCommerce is not suitable for you if you want to use a CMS other than WordPress. The particular plug-in works better only with WordPress and may not be compatible with non-WordPress sites.

2. Included Hidden Expenses  

WooCommerce may need to improve vital SEO tools on other platforms through standalone plug-ins. To that end, you may need to acquire additional plug-ins to maintain competitiveness with other relevant stores.

Although there are no initial expenses associated with WooCommerce, the incorporation of extensions, business utilities, and inventory management tools require some additional costs to improve the efficiency of your workflow and save you time and effort. Therefore, you cannot prevent these “hidden” costs when using WooCommerce. 

3. Using Plug-ins Can Challenging

WooCommerce integrates with over 1,000 plug-ins, but these are separate software modules that require additional processing power, memory, and internet bandwidth. Extension overload may lead to a decline in website performance because of the strain on memory resources. Therefore, you must incorporate jQuery, CSS, or HTML to preserve a lightweight and more responsive website.

4. No Tax or Legal Regulations

WooCommerce lacks all kinds of legal documentation, like data protection, declarations,  terms and conditions, or revocations. These could provide legal or taxation challenges in the future, which may disrupt your operations.

2. Shift4Shop

Shift4Shop is an all-encompassing and unique eCommerce solution that helps businesses meet their needs without any charge. This platform is one of the best WooCommerce alternatives because it offers a package of tools and services for building secure sites, such as a free drag-and-drop website builder and mobile-friendly templates that are also SEO-optimized.

Key Features

Shift4Shop provides several features, including:

  • Product and Inventory Management: Simplify your inventory control by conducting automatic stock counts through the system whenever orders are received. Furthermore, every product in your catalog will have a record sheet, which makes it easier to arrange and monitor the inventory.
  • Order Management: Improve your organization's efficiency with a dedicated order dashboard, invoice number with customer information, and an RMA (Return Merchandise Authorization) system for simplified product return or replacement. 
  • Marketing and SEO Tools: Increase your online shop’s sales by improving its SEO. This WooCommerce alternative offers SEO optimization tools like internal link building, Google Analytics integration, custom domain registration, and schema markup for improved communication with numerous web engines. 

3. Ecwid

Ecwid is another eCommerce platform that enables you to create and manage an online store easily without any coding or design knowledge. The platform also helps you sell products across numerous channels, including marketplaces, social media, and even your own website. Furthermore, Ecwid provides various attractive templates to build your eCommerce website. It also provides tools for streamlining your processes, such as orders, payments, and business progress.

Key Features

Ecwid offers a range of features, including:

  • Platform Integration: Ecwid can be integrated with popular platforms like WordPress, Tumblr, Blogger, and Joomla. This enables you to manage your operations from a single infrastructure.
  • Scalable Plans: The free plan is suitable for up to ten products. The platform also has other plans to suit your business needs over time. With paid plans, you also get some additional features, including selling digital goods, inventory control, and coupons.
  • Marketing: Grow your business with Ecwid’s marketing solutions, such as automated social media ads, target-based ads, and built-in email marketing support.

Q3. Is WooCommerce completely free to use?

The WooCommerce platform itself does not have pricing. However, to make your store functional, you will have to purchase various extensions within the WooCommerce infrastructure. You may even purchase the enterprise version of WooCommerce with the cost tailored to your needs.
